Commedia all’Italiana (Italian comedy) is the term used to indicate a cinematographic genre that arose in Italy during the fifties of the twentieth century and developed in the subsequent sixties and seventies. The expression was coined by paraphrasing the title of one of the greatest successes of the early years of this film genre, the film Divorzio all’italiana by director Pietro Germi.
